Neighborhood Overview
Mallard Lake Golf Center is situated on the outskirts of Yuba City, a community in California's fertile Central Valley, approximately 40 miles north of Sacramento. The facility is conveniently located just off State Route 99 (Swy 99), providing direct access for many travelers. The immediate area is characterized by agricultural landscapes and open spaces, with Yuba City's commercial and residential zones a short drive away. Access to the golf center is primarily from the highway, with clear signage directing visitors to the main entrance. For those flying in, Sacramento International Airport (SMF) is the closest major airport, located about an hour's drive south. Driving times can vary depending on traffic, particularly during peak commute hours on Route 99, though congestion is generally less severe than in larger metropolitan areas. Public transportation options are limited in this more rural setting, making personal vehicles or rideshares the most practical modes of transport for reaching the golf center. Planning your arrival, especially on busy tournament days, means considering the highway's flow and aiming for an early entrance to avoid any potential delays.

Weather & Seasons
Winter
Winter in Yuba City is generally mild, with daytime temperatures often ranging from the high 40s to the low 60s Fahrenheit. Rainfall is most common during these months, so packing a waterproof jacket and umbrella is wise. Playable conditions can still be found on most days, but early morning frost or lingering dampness might affect the course. Layered clothing is recommended for variable temperatures.
Spring & early summer
Spring brings warmer temperatures, with highs climbing into the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it. The weather is typically pleasant and sunny, making it an ideal time for golf. Rainfall decreases significantly compared to winter. Light layers are generally sufficient, but a light jacket might be useful for cooler mornings or evenings. Hydration becomes more important as the days get longer and warmer.
Mid-summer
Mid-summer, from June through August, is characterized by significant heat, with daytime temperatures frequently exceeding 90°F and sometimes reaching over 100°F. Early morning tee times are highly recommended to avoid the peak heat. Lightweight, breathable clothing is essential, and bringing plenty of water, sunscreen, and a hat is crucial for comfort and safety on the course.
Fall season
Fall offers a return to more moderate temperatures, with highs typically in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, gradually cooling into the 60s. The weather is often sunny and crisp, providing excellent golfing conditions. This season is very popular for outdoor activities. Light layers are usually all that's needed, though evenings can get cooler.
Rain & snow
Rain is most frequent during the winter months and can occasionally occur in the fall and spring. Snow is extremely rare in this part of California's Central Valley. When rain is present, courses may become wet and potentially slow, though Mallard Lake Golf Center typically has good drainage. Always check conditions before heading out if rain is in the forecast.
